First the seat belt light flashes on, then ALL the lights on the dashboard come on. My gauges drop - accelerator, RPM and temperature (fuel gauge remains steady). Lasts for up to a minute, then everything returns to normal. This happens sometimes only once, other days happens 4-5 times in a row. Numerous similar complaints on Internet. Some says this leads to engine cutting out while driving?! Wonder why Chrysler is not addressing this seemingly common problem with the 2006 models of PT Cruiser. Any recourse?
Update from Jun 20, 2014: Dealer instructed by Chrysler to replace the ignition. Cost was $500+. We submitted the expense to Chrysler, via snail mail, seeking reimbursement. Clearly this is a problem the car mfr is aware of and should be addressing. Someone is going to be seriously hurt or killed by these cars losing power while driving
